WALKERS
Today's reading:  Proverbs 13
 
"Whoever walks with the wise will become wise, whoever walks with fools will suffer harm."  Proverbs 13:20 NLT
 
My friend, Karen, and I have a standing appointment to walk three mornings a week.  While many others are still snoozing, we're cardiovascularly challenging ourselves--and talking (when we can breathe) up a storm.
 
I've seen this verse play out in our walks. Karen is wise.  I've gleaned a lot of knowledge from her on our early morning dates. She's a Mom of two boys who are older than my son, so I'm taking notes as to what might work when Isaiah reaches the age her boys are.  I've gotten a few recipes from her on our walks.  I've even been given a few pointers for my flower garden as we huff and puff our way up and down the road.  I've also burned a few extra calories trying to keep up with her very long strides.  
 
Now that I think of it, is she gaining any wisdom from me?  Is this a one-sided relationship?  Does she grow as a person from time spent with me?  
 
Is anyone I sidle up beside growing wiser, in the things of life or the things of God?  My child?  My co-workers?  My checker at the grocery?
